    The Firefighter problem asks how many vertices can be saved from a fire spreading over the vertices of a graph. At timestep 0 a vertex begins burning, then on each subsequent timestep a non-burning vertex is chosen to be defended, and the fire then spreads to all undefended vertices that it neighbours. The problem is NP-Complete on arbitrary graphs, however existing work has found several graph classes for which there are polynomial time solutions. We introduce Temporal Firefighter, an extension of Firefighter to temporal graphs. We show that Temporal Firefighter is also NP-Complete, and remains so on all but one of the underlying classes of graphs on which Firefighter is known to have a polynomial-time solution. This motivates us to explore restrictions on the temporal structure of the graph, and we find that Temporal Firefighter is fixed parameter tractable with respect to the temporal graph parameter vertex-interval-membership-width

    It is well known that fighting a fire is a hard task. The Firefighter problem asks how to optimally deploy firefighters to defend the vertices of a graph from a fire. This problem is NP-Complete on all but a few classes of graphs. Thankfully, firefighters do not have to work alone, and are often aided by the efforts of good natured civillians who slow the spread of a fire by maintaining firebreaks when they are able. We will show that this help, although well-intentioned, unfortunately makes the optimal deployment of firefighters an even harder problem. To model this scenario we introduce the Temporal Firefighter problem, an extension of Firefighter to temporal graphs. We show that Temporal Firefighter is also NP-Complete, and remains so on all but one of the underlying classes of graphs on which Firefighter is known to have polynomial time solutions. This motivates us to explore making use of the temporal structure of the graph in our search for tractability, and we conclude by presenting an FPT algorithm for Temporal Firefighter with respect to the temporal graph parameter vertex-interval-membership-width

    Jessica Hagedorn Born and raised in the Philippines, Jessica Hagedorn is well-known as a performance artist, poet, and playwright. She is the author of the novel Dogeaters (Penguin), which was nominated for the National Book Award. Hagedorn wrote the screenplay for Fresh Kill, an independent first feature film directed and produced by Shu Lea Cheang and has collaborated on film projects, Color Schemes and Those Fluttering Objects of Desire. Her multimedia theater pieces include Teenytown, The Art of War: Nine situations, and Holy Food. Hagedorn is the recipient of a 1994 Lila Wallace Reader’s Digest Writers Award, and a 1995 NEA Creative Writing Fellowship. Her new novel, The Gangster of Love has been recently released by Houghton Mifflin

    Temporal graphs provide a useful model for many real-world networks. Unfortunately, the majority of algorithmic problems we might consider on such graphs are intractable. There has been recent progress in defining structural parameters which describe tractable cases by simultaneously restricting the underlying structure and the times at which edges appear in the graph. These all rely on the temporal graph being sparse in some sense. We introduce temporal analogues of three increasingly restrictive static graph parameters - cliquewidth, modular-width and neighbourhood diversity - which take small values for highly structured temporal graphs, even if a large number of edges are active at each timestep. The computational problems solvable efficiently when the temporal cliquewidth of the input graph is bounded form a subset of those solvable efficiently when the temporal modular-width is bounded, which is in turn a subset of problems efficiently solvable when the temporal neighbourhood diversity is bounded. By considering specific temporal graph problems, we demonstrate that (up to standard complexity theoretic assumptions) these inclusions are strict

    In this audiovisual recording from Thursday, March 24, 2022, as part of the 53rd Annual UND Writers Conference: “Communities and the Individual,” Jessica Bruder reads excerpts from Nomadland. Bruder discusses what it means to be an immersion journalist and what brought her to write Nomadland. Bruder also responds to audience questions about the dynamic between author and those who share their stories for a novel like Nomadland, the connection between immersive journalism and the new journalism literary movement, the process of collecting, organizing, and transforming material into a novel, how faithful the film version of Nomadland was to the book, and if Linda ever got to build her Earthship.
